Output 16868ec5c9eef090488d74e719f9c39bcbb60488a92f23adc9cef7d0d68db1e8:2

value
195734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af87a31d60869089e88f4ae0a2d6924682a26d89 OP_EQUAL
address
3Hh8fMEWJx1SG3fxP2uL5EyrHWYPpjbiJm
transaction
16868ec5c9eef090488d74e719f9c39bcbb60488a92f23adc9cef7d0d68db1e8
spent
true